The makers of foam foundation forms want you to believe that the fourth little pig, had there been one, would have built his house out of polystyrene and concrete. Flip through any building magazine and you’ll find that the manufacturers of rigid-foam concrete forms are spending a bundle on ads extolling the virtues of their products. Is it time for you to jump in and try one of them? Maybe. The 25 builders I interviewed for this story noted some quality advantages to foam forms and intend to keep on using them.
